We are searching for a Program Manager who will play a pivotal role in shaping ourselves as a tech leader in the US market. The Program Manager will oversee the planning, execution, and delivery of product initiatives in our Search Engine Marketing space. This role requires a strong background in project management, excellent communication skills, and the ability to work effectively with cross-functional teams, particularly in Marketing, Product and Engineering. Experience in the affiliate marketing space and paid marketing is preferential.
This is an exciting opportunity to lead and influence the key areas of our business, while working in an environment that values innovation, creativity, and adaptability.
Responsibilities:- Oversee the end-to-end delivery of projects within Paid Marketing team, supporting the Search Engine Marketing teams across all verticals.
- Develop detailed project plans, including timelines, resource allocation, and risk management.
- Ensure projects are delivered on time, within scope, and within budget.
- Collaborate with stakeholders, technical and product teams and third parties to define project requirements and deliverables.
- Facilitate communication and coordination between cross-functional teams.
- Monitor team performance and provide guidance to ensure project objectives are met.
- Serve as the primary point of contact for project-related communications with internal and external stakeholders.
- Provide regular updates to senior leaders on project status, risks, and issues.
- Manage stakeholder expectations and ensure alignment on project goals and outcomes.
- Collaborate with key stakeholder teams in the Social and Native to ensure successful product launches, adoption, and customer satisfaction.
- Proven track record of successfully managing complex projects from initiation to completion.
- Strong knowledge of project management methodologies (e.g., Agile, Scrum, Waterfall).
- Excellent communication, interpersonal, and leadership skills.
-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.
- Experience with project management tools such as JIRA, Trello, or Microsoft Project.
- PMP, PRINCE2, or similar project management certification is a plus.
- Experience in the Financial Services, Insurance, Home, Health, or Legal sectors.
- Familiarity with the digital media landscape and publisher platforms.
- Experience in affiliate marketing and paid marketing.
- Understanding of lead generation and comparison journey processes.
